Abstract
The method uses predictive analysis to determine a model based on past data including a first social network built between communicating entities for a first observation period and behavioral centrality measures derived from behavioral data observed in a following time period. The model thus determined is then applied to a second social network built for a second observation period more recent than the first one. This provides predicted behavioral centrality measures for a future period, which can be used to perform an efficient selection of entities in the target, which may maximize virality with respect to the specific behavior of interest.
